Dear ag-tech, Following on from the recent email about the HPC-Europa project (www.hpc-europa.org), I'd like to mention a few things we are considering working on here at EPCC (www.epcc.ed.ac.uk):
o Visual identification of "active" window (the window(s) in which someone is speaking) based on output from RAT. o A means to start/control VNC from within Access Grid, and possibly associate a VNC session with a venue. - Does anyone know of any previous attempts to integrate aspects of VNC, as opposed to just running it side-by-side with AG? I've noticed something called VenueVNC in CVS, but I don't know what stage this is at, and what functionality it has. o A means to easily "moderate" an Access Grid session so that a chair person could easily mute/change the volume of the different audio streams involved in the session. These changes could be broadcast to all sites. o Improvements to integration of a whiteboard tool with AG. - I know that various shared-whiteboard tools are already available, so I don't know to what extent there's anything to be done on this subject. However, I know that here at EPCC we don't regularly use such software and I think that many people would find it useful. If anyone has any experience of using such tools and has identified any short-comings on which we could work, I'd be interested to hear. o A (web-based?) tool to share an agenda or tick-list for a meeting. - I guess something like this could maybe be done with the help of the shared browser.
